Sales leads should expect a two-week overlap period with duplicate tracking references; quote standard delivery windows unchanged. Returns routing shifts to the Ashgrove depot. Customer-facing messaging is optional until the cutover is confirmed. Cost savings are meaningful and partially fund the service-tier upgrades discussed last month. The confidential commercial rationale is set out in the note below.

internal memo for hahif-hahaf: Headcount on the Zorwyn team goes from 9 to 100 by the end of October. Gross margin on Zorwyn came in at 5 percent against a plan of 10 percent.

**Alert: Planner regression — Graywick query latency**

This alert fires when the Graywick query planner chooses sequential scans on tables that previously used index paths, pushing median latency above threshold. Historically this follows statistics refresh failures or a planner version bump. Check the last ANALYZE run and recent engine upgrades before forcing plan hints. Known regressions, diagnosis steps, and the rollback procedure are tracked on the page below.

runbook for badug-kadup: https://confluence.zemvarlabs.internal/projects/browse/display/projects/bd1b

### v3.2.0 — Renamed setting

Keyspindle no longer reads `KS_ROTATE_TOKEN`; it was renamed for consistency with the plugin API. Plugins targeting 3.2+ must use the new name or rotation hooks will not fire. The old name is ignored silently — no deprecation warning is emitted. Update your `.env` before upgrading. Keep `KS_PLUGIN_DIR` and `KS_LOG_LEVEL` as-is. Immediately after those entries, add the renamed token line with your existing value.

secret setting of kawif-kajef: COURIER_KEY3=d2b